Rough translation [I HATE legalistic Spanish]. Basically, Ely presented his marriage license/certificate to the Mexican authorities to have it recognized in Mexico. I've broken the document up into paragraphs to make it more understandable. I don't know why there isn't full data for Ely. I gave up in the last paragraph. [Sorry].
In Mérida, at 8 o/c in the morning [crossed out and amended to 16 hours and 40 minutes] on 25 [crossed out and amended to 20] of September 1924 Mr. Ely Ness, 47 years old, married, merchant, temporarily in this city and resident in the city of New York, appeared before me, José Evaristo Iturralde, General Director of the State Civil Registry and Official of the Capital Branch presenting a duly legalized certificate as proof of his marriage to Mrs. Bessie Fellman, 40 years of age,
in the city of Brooklyn, NY, United States on 26 January 1913 and requesting that, in accordance with articles 135 of the
Code and 55 of the Civil Code reformed by decrees number 331 and 332 of 2 April 1923, this certificate which, faithfully translated by Mr. Benturo? Ríos Franco reads as follows:
"New York State Department of Health, Bureau of Demographic Statistics, Marriage License, This certificate permits any person authorized by the law to celebrate marriages in the State of New York [blah, blah, blah] to perform the rites of marriage between Ely Ness of Brooklyn, Kings County, NY and Bessie Fellman of Brooklyn, Kings County, NY and to deliver under his signature and official ministerial seal that the subjects are those referred to in this certificate. All of the data transcribed here and subscribed by me are true and correct as [they] appear in the statements made to me by [can't read this bit - page cut off] .......
..... marriage: First. Previous spouse or spouses, living or dead: None. Is the subject divorced: No. Name: Bessie Fellman. Color: White. Residence: 260 ?? Street. Age: 30 years. Occupation: Seamstress. Birth place: ?? Russia. Father's name: Lazar. Birth place: [cut off]. Mother's name: Augusta Landeman? Birth place: [cut off].
Number of marriage: First. Previous spouse or spouses, living or dead: None. Is the subject divorced: No.
Marriage Certificate
I, David Shapiro, Rabi, residing at 173 Floyd Street in Kings County, NY, certify that on 26 January 1913 in the city of Brooklyn, Kings County, NY I have performed the marriage of Ely Ness of Brooklyn, Kings County, NY and Bessie Fellman of Brooklyn, Kings County, NY in the presence of Max Ness and [cut off] Shaffer as witnesses, the license for which is [I can't make this bit out]. Present: Max Ness, y ? Shaffer. - David Shapiro, 173 Floyd Street, Brooklyn, NY."
.... in the Consulate of Mexico in the city of New York, signed by Alberto Mascareños? and dated 3 September 1924. Signed by the translator of [cut off]: Benturo Ríos Franco, single, lawyer and Edilberto? Banerdo?, merchant, both of full age and blah, blah, blah .....
